The party piece of the Envoy is that you can convert it from SUV to truck. You can slide the rear of the roof forwards, retract the tailgate window and erect a midgate behind the seats.

Does putting in regular gas while it only takes premium gas cause it to self detonate ?
>>17555781
It can lead to pre-ignition, where the fuel ignites before the spark plug fires. This can cause massive damage to an engine.
If an owners manual say to sue premium fuel, use fucking premium. But if it says to use regular than putting premium in it won't hurt the car, but it's also wasted money because it won't do anything unless you tune the computer for it.
